Fraunhofer diffraction at the two-dimensional quadratically distorted (QD) Grating

Published 14 Sep 2017 in physics.optics and physics.class-ph | (1710.00645v2)

Abstract: A two-dimensional (2D) mathematical model of quadratically distorted (QD) grating is established with the principles of Fraunhofer diffraction and Fourier optics. Discrete sampling and bisection algorithm are applied for finding numerical solution of the diffraction pattern of QD grating. This 2D mathematical model allows the precise design of QD grating and improves the optical performance of simultaneous multiplane imaging system.
